B1381
B1381 Code Symptoms, Causes, Diagnosis, Repair Costs & Solutions
Quick Summary
- B1381 means the oil‑change‑reset button circuit is open – the switch or its wiring isn’t completing the circuit.
- The most common driver‑visible sign is a persistent oil‑change reminder that cannot be cleared.
- Diagnosis starts with a scan, visual wiring check, and continuity test on the reset switch circuit.
- Repair usually involves cleaning, repairing wiring, or replacing the switch; replacement of the body‑control module (BCM) is considered when the circuit is internally damaged.
- Proper maintenance of the button and its connector prevents recurrence.
B1381 Code Symptoms, Causes, and How to Fix the Issue
Drivers notice a stubborn oil‑change reminder light or message that stays illuminated even after a fresh oil change. The warning may flash on the instrument cluster, appear on the digital display, or be stored as a service‑interval reminder that cannot be reset through the usual menu. In some vehicles the reminder may also trigger a “Service Required” chime. Because the code specifically points to an open circuit in the reset button, no other warning lights (engine, ABS, airbags) are typically illuminated.
Symptoms
- Oil‑change reminder light or message remains on after oil has been changed.
- Attempting to reset the reminder via the button or dashboard menu has no effect.
- The reminder may reappear after each drive cycle, indicating the system never receives a reset signal.
- No loss of power, no loss of other body functions (lights, locks) – the issue is isolated to the oil‑change reminder circuit.
Why This Happens – Common Causes
Open Circuit in the Reset Switch
The reset button contains a microswitch that closes the circuit when pressed. If the internal contacts burn out or become misaligned, the circuit stays open, generating B1381.
Faulty Reset Button Assembly
Manufacturing defects, wear from repeated presses, or exposure to moisture can cause the button’s contacts to corrode or break, preventing a proper electrical connection.
Damaged Wiring Harness or Connector
The wire harness that routes the signal from the button to the body‑control module (BCM) may suffer chafing, pinched sections, or broken pins in the connector. A single broken conductor creates an open circuit.
Corroded or Loose Connector Pins
Exposure to water, road salt, or cleaning chemicals can corrode the pins that mate the button harness to the BCM. Loose pins create intermittent or permanent open circuits.
Internal BCM Circuit Failure
When the BCM’s driver circuitry that monitors the reset button fails, the module cannot detect a closed switch even though the button and wiring are intact. This internal fault also registers as B1381.
Diagnostic and Repair Procedures
- Scan for B1381 – Connect a factory‑level scan tool to read the code and confirm that no additional codes are present. Clear the code and re‑scan after a test drive to verify persistence.
- Visual Inspection – Locate the oil‑change‑reset button (often on the instrument panel or steering column). Examine the button housing for moisture, debris, or physical damage. Follow the harness to the BCM and inspect the connector for corrosion or loose pins.
- Continuity Test – With the ignition off, disconnect the button harness. Use a multimeter to measure resistance between the two circuit pins. An open reading (infinite resistance) confirms a broken circuit.
- Switch Actuation Test – While monitoring the multimeter, press the reset button. A sudden drop to near‑zero resistance indicates a functional switch; no change confirms a faulty button.
- Wiring Integrity Check – Trace the harness for pinched sections or exposed wires. Perform a continuity test along the entire length; repair any broken conductors with heat‑shrink tubing or replace the harness segment.
- Connector Cleaning – If corrosion is present, clean the pins with electrical contact cleaner and a soft brush. Re‑torque the connector to manufacturer specifications (typically 5‑7 Nm).
- BCM Communication Test – Use the scan tool to read live data from the BCM. Verify that the module reports the button status (open/closed). If the module never reports a closed status despite a confirmed good switch, the BCM driver circuit is likely defective.
- Reprogramming – Some vehicles require a reset of the service‑interval counter after repairing the button. Follow the manufacturer’s procedure to re‑initialize the oil‑change reminder, which may involve a specific key‑on/off sequence or a software reset via the scan tool.
- Repair vs. Replace Decision – If the button or wiring is the only fault, replace the button assembly (typically $30‑$80) and repair the harness. If the BCM fails the communication test, consider module replacement.
Typical labor for button or wiring repair ranges from $80‑$150, while BCM replacement plus programming runs $400‑$700 plus labor.
When Replacement Makes More Sense Than Repair
Repeated attempts to repair a damaged button or wiring that continues to open, or a BCM that fails internal diagnostics, indicate that a replacement module will provide a more reliable long‑term solution. Module repair can be a temporary fix, but internal driver failures often re‑appear after a short drive cycle, leading to recurring service alerts.
Flagship One specializes in VIN‑matched control modules, providing a plug‑and‑drive replacement that is pre‑programmed to your vehicle’s specifications. Modern control modules integrate security, immobilizer, and service‑interval functions, so correct programming is essential. A Flagship One unit arrives fully calibrated, backed by a warranty, and eliminates the guesswork of aftermarket re‑programming.
Preventive Maintenance
- Clean the Reset Button – Periodically wipe the button surface with a dry cloth to prevent moisture accumulation.
- Inspect the Connector – During routine service intervals, check the button harness connector for signs of corrosion or looseness; tighten or clean as needed.
- Avoid Excessive Force – Press the button gently; aggressive use can wear the microswitch contacts prematurely.
- Protect Wiring from Damage – When removing interior panels for other repairs, route the harness away from sharp edges or moving components.
- Update BCM Software – Manufacturers occasionally release firmware updates that improve sensor handling and service‑interval logic; applying these updates during scheduled maintenance can prevent false‑positive B1381 occurrences.
Service Recommendation: Most issues related to this fault are diagnosed and corrected through inspection, wiring repair, and calibration rather than module replacement. For modules not typically replaced through aftermarket suppliers, diagnosis and repair should be performed by a certified automotive technician with access to factory service information and tooling.
Frequently Asked Questions